Af•ro•a•si•at•ic  (af′rō ā′zhē atik, -ā′shē-, -ā′zē-),USA pronunciation adj. 
  1. Language Varietiesof, belonging to, or pertaining to Afroasiatic;
    Hamito-Semitic.

n. 
  1. Language VarietiesAlso called Hamito-Semitic. a family of languages including as subfamilies Semitic, Egyptian, Berber, Cushitic, and Chadic. Cf. family (def. 14).
Also, Af′ro-A′si•atic. 
  • Afro- + Asiatic 1955–60
